From 895d5857f91ee440db799577118ff4992c9a1991 Mon Sep 17 00:00:00 2001 From: Eli Bosley Date: Thu, 23 Jan 2025 16:20:34 -0500 Subject: [PATCH] feat: remove apiKey from server --- web/_data/serverState.ts | 1 - web/_webGui/testWebComponents.page | 1 - web/components/DownloadApiLogs.ce.vue | 4 +--- web/helpers/create-apollo-client.ts | 1 - web/store/server.ts | 7 ------- web/types/server.ts | 1 - 6 files changed, 1 insertion(+), 14 deletions(-) diff --git a/web/_data/serverState.ts b/web/_data/serverState.ts index a1c4e91f6..cd983b4a2 100644 --- a/web/_data/serverState.ts +++ b/web/_data/serverState.ts @@ -146,7 +146,6 @@ export const serverState: Server = { showBannerGradient: 'yes', partnerLogo: true, }, - apiKey: 'unupc_fab6ff6ffe51040595c6d9ffb63a353ba16cc2ad7d93f813a2e80a5810', avatar: 'https://source.unsplash.com/300x300/?portrait', config: { id: 'config-id', diff --git a/web/_webGui/testWebComponents.page b/web/_webGui/testWebComponents.page index c789a858c..fd7b87af7 100644 --- a/web/_webGui/testWebComponents.page +++ b/web/_webGui/testWebComponents.page @@ -68,7 +68,6 @@ if (!file_exists('/var/lib/pkgtools/packages/dynamix.unraid.net') && !file_exist } $serverData = [ - "apiKey" => $myservers['upc']['apikey'] ?? '', "apiVersion" => $myservers['api']['version'] ?? '', "avatar" => (!empty($myservers['remote']['avatar']) && $connectPluginInstalled) ? $myservers['remote']['avatar'] : '', "banner" => $display['banner'] ?? '', diff --git a/web/components/DownloadApiLogs.ce.vue b/web/components/DownloadApiLogs.ce.vue index 53d4dbfba..e663778f0 100644 --- a/web/components/DownloadApiLogs.ce.vue +++ b/web/components/DownloadApiLogs.ce.vue @@ -8,9 +8,7 @@ import { useI18n } from 'vue-i18n'; const { t } = useI18n(); -const { apiKey } = storeToRefs(useServerStore()); - -const downloadUrl = computed(() => new URL(`/graphql/api/logs?apiKey=${apiKey.value}`, WEBGUI_GRAPHQL)); +const downloadUrl = computed(() => new URL(`/graphql/api/logs`, WEBGUI_GRAPHQL));